About the series
In this delightfully absurd French series from Dargaud, a hapless everyman stumbles into the role of a bumbling superhero named Supermurgeman. Running from 2002 to the present across five issues, the strip plays on classic superhero tropes with a distinctly Gallic sense of deadpan humor and visual wit. The series is best known for the sharp, minimalist cartooning of its creator, who turns the mundane frustrations of daily life into a source of gentle, laugh-out-loud comedy. It matters as a charming, understated cult gem that proves a superhero story needs neither capes nor cosmic stakes to be truly memorable.
